引言:什么是區塊鏈?

區塊鏈作為一種多元化的技術,不僅僅是比特幣的基礎,更是未來數字經濟的核心。很多人提到區塊鏈的時候,可能會局限于它的貨幣屬性,但實際上,它的應用場景廣泛,比如智能合約、供應鏈管理、數字版權等。我記得小時候第一次聽說比特幣時,感覺這個概念神秘又新穎,沒想到如今真的可以通過學習開發自己的幣種和區塊鏈平臺。

第一步:明確你的目標

如何開發幣種區塊鏈平臺:實用指南與經驗分享

開發區塊鏈平臺之前,首先要明確你的目標和用途。你是想創建一種新的數字貨幣,還是希望實現一些特定功能的應用?比如,你可以考慮為某個行業提供解決方案,或者是為特定的用戶群體設計一款新穎的產品。我在大學時選修了一門區塊鏈課程,教授曾經說過,“如果你不知道自己想要什么,再好的技術也不會幫助你?!边@句話讓我印象深刻。

第二步:選擇區塊鏈框架

根據你的需求,選擇一個合適的區塊鏈框架是關鍵?,F在市場上有許多開源區塊鏈框架,比如Ethereum、Hyperledger Fabric、EOS等。每一種框架都有其特定的優缺點,以及適合的應用場景。例如,Ethereum非常適合智能合約和去中心化應用,而Hyperledger則更適合企業級的解決方案。選擇框架時,你不僅要考慮技術特點,還要評估其社區支持和文檔的完整性。早在我入門區塊鏈開發時,我犯過一次重大錯誤,就是沒有充分研究合適的技術棧,導致后續開發過程異常艱難。

第三步:技術準備與學習

如何開發幣種區塊鏈平臺:實用指南與經驗分享

對于區塊鏈開發,掌握相關的編程語言和技術是必不可少的。Ethereum常用Solidity語言,而其他區塊鏈可能使用不同的語言,如Java、Go等。我建議進行深入學習和實踐,可以通過在線課程、技術文檔、開源項目等來進行全面的技能儲備。自學的過程雖然愉快,但也充滿挑戰。有時候在 Stack Overflow 上看到問題解答,可以讓我感受到與全球開發者的連接,仿佛我并不孤單。

第四步:設計與架構

確定你的區塊鏈平臺架構設計是非常關鍵的環節。此時,你需要考慮區塊鏈的共識機制、節點類型、安全性和擴展性等問題。比如選擇 Proof of Work 還是 Proof of Stake,都是影響后續運營的重要決策。設計過程中,可以嘗試采用模塊化思路,這樣可以在面對變化需求時,進行快速應對。在設計日記中,我曾記錄過自己的設計思路,回頭看會讓我感受到自己的成長和思維的變化。

第五步:開發與測試

在完成設計后,就進入了開發階段。此時應該選擇合適的開發工具,如Truffle、Ganache等,進行區塊鏈應用的構建和測試。開發過程中,應該頻繁進行單元測試和功能測試,確保系統的穩定性和安全性?;叵肫鹞业谝淮瓮ㄟ^寫代碼成功部署合約的心情,難以忘懷,那種成就感無與倫比。然而,開發也不乏挫折,調試時反復出現的錯誤讓我感受到自己技術的不足。不過,這些經歷也鍛煉了我的耐心與解決問題的能力。

第六步:上線與推廣

完成開發后的上線過程同樣重要。上線后,如何推廣你的區塊鏈項目,吸引用戶關注至關重要??梢酝ㄟ^社交媒體、社區活動、技術論壇等方式進行宣傳。此外,設立激勵措施、空投等活動,也可以吸引早期用戶。這個環節我覺得十分有趣,因為可以通過互動了解用戶反饋,持續產品。參與這種互動讓我想起了小時候參加學校社團時的熱情,充滿活力和創意的交流總是激發更多的靈感。

第七步:持續迭代與

區塊鏈項目并不是一蹴而就的,持續更新和功能拓展是必要的。獲取用戶反饋,分析數據,以及定期進行技術升級,都是保持競爭力的重要方式。我相信,一段良好的用戶關系可以帶來長久的成功。在我參與的某個項目迭代中,通過用戶的反饋,我們了許多功能,得到了用戶的認可。這讓我意識到,傾聽用戶的聲音至關重要。

結語:未來的區塊鏈世界

開發幣種區塊鏈平臺的旅程雖然充滿挑戰,但也是成長和學習的絕佳機會。隨著技術的進步和市場的變化,未來的區塊鏈勢必會更加多樣化。無論是技術層面的提升,還是用戶體驗的,都是區塊鏈開發者需要不斷追求的目標。我希望這篇分享能為你在區塊鏈開發的道路上提供一些實用的啟發,也愿我們都能在這個充滿可能的領域中找到屬于自己的方向與成功。

最后,鼓勵每一個對區塊鏈感興趣的人,不要害怕嘗試和挑戰。正如我當初的心路歷程,勇敢跨出第一步,未來的路會因為你的努力而變得更加精彩。